Effective Strategies for Choosing the Best Wig

Selecting the ideal layered lace front wig requires careful consideration. Follow these tips to make an informed decision:

Strategy Description
Determine Your Face Shape Different face shapes flatter specific wig styles. Oval faces can wear any style, while round faces look better with longer wigs.
Choose the Right Density Wig density refers to the amount of hair on the wig cap. Low-density wigs are lightweight and natural-looking, while high-density wigs offer more volume.

Key Considerations for Wig Care and Maintenance

Properly caring for your layered lace front wig is essential for its longevity. Implement these practices:

Care Tip Maintenance Description
Wash Gently Use lukewarm water and a mild shampoo specifically designed for wigs.
Avoid Heat Styling Excessive heat can damage the wig's fibers. Use low heat settings if necessary.
Store Properly Protect your wig from dust and moisture by storing it in a wig bag or box when not in use.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Wearing Wigs

To avoid common pitfalls, follow these tips:

Mistake Recommendation
Choosing an Inappropriate Wig Consider your face shape, hair texture, and personal style when selecting a wig.
Over-Styling the Wig Excessive hairspray or styling products can weigh down the wig and make it look unnatural.
Failing to Clean the Wig Regularly Dirt and oil can accumulate over time, making the wig appear dull and unhygienic.

Getting Started with Layered Lace Front Wigs

Follow this step-by-step approach to achieve a flawless wig application:

  1. Prepare Your Natural Hair: Braid or cornrow your natural hair to create a smooth base.
  2. Apply Wig Cap: Place a wig cap over your hair to prevent slippage and absorb moisture.
  3. Position the Wig: Align the wig's hairline with your natural hairline and gently secure it with clips or glue.
  4. Style the Wig: Brush and style the wig to your desired look using a wide-toothed comb.
